Buy-Side Technology Awards 2013: Best Overall Buy-Side Product for 2013—LCH.Clearnet

This year, LCH.Clearnet joins past recipients Markit (2008), Algorithmics and Fidessa (2009), Cadis (2010), SmartStream (2011), and Advise Technologies (2012), in the winners’ circle of the most prestigious product category of the awards, thanks to its SwapClear Margin Approximation Risk Tool (Smart), which, earlier in the day, won the best risk/portfolio analytics, and best risk management initiative over the last 12 months categories.
In terms of awards, this year has been a successful one for LCH.Clearnet, born in 2003 through the merger of the London Clearing House and Paris-based Clearnet: Its three wins in this year’s BST Awards come on the back of its success in the best sell-side market risk product category at this year’s inaugural Sell-Side Technology Awards held in New York on April 23. However, given the challenges facing both buy-side and sell-side firms when it comes to calculating their initial margin requirements—the percentage of the total market value of a security paid for in cash by an investor—it’s not hard to see why. After all, Smart is designed specifically to eliminate the guesswork in this respect, by providing users with what amounts to “what-if” functionality to calculate how their initial margin requirements will be affected by simulated trades on an individual or portfolio-wide basis. This helps users extrapolate reliable, repeatable and transparent initial margin calculations, allowing them to simulate portfolio risk exposure in real time. Crucially, Smart is available via three delivery mechanisms: on users’ desktops, through code-library integration with clients’ applications, and via the Bloomberg Professional Service, flexibility that both buy-side and sell-side firms now expect from their service providers.
